Islands suffer 24-hour power cut
About 150 homes on two of the Isles of Scilly suffered a power cut lasting just over 24 hours.

Electricity supplies failed on Bryher and Tresco on Thursday night.

Western Power Distribution was in the process of shipping emergency generators to the islands when the fault was repaired.

The company said that its engineers managed to fix the fault, which was located in a cable on Tresco, just after 2100 BST on Friday night.
